ICB and Sage Payroll FAQs
The Institute of Certified Bookkeepers (ICB) is a professional organisation that provides recognised qualifications in bookkeeping, accounting, and payroll. As one of the largest bookkeeping organisations in the world, they're widely respected by employers in the finance industry.
Designed to teach practical, job-ready skills that can help you start or progress in your career, ICB courses typically cover areas like financial records, payroll processes, tax compliance, and accounting software.

Sage is a leading global provider of business software used by companies around the world to manage tasks like accounting, payroll, and financial reporting.
Many organisations around the world rely on Sage software to process employee pay, calculate tax, and keep up-to-date payroll records.
With Sage being so widely used in the finance industry, learning how to use Sage payroll software is a particularly valuable skill when starting your career.
Since employers often look for candidates who are already familiar with payroll systems, an ICB and Sage payroll course gives you a major leg up.
Yes, payroll can be a great career choice, especially if you’re looking for a stable role with strong long-term demand!
Every organisation needs payroll professionals to ensure employees are paid correctly and on time, which means payroll positions are in demand across nearly every industry.
Starting a career in payroll can open the door to a range of opportunities, too. Many professionals begin in entry-level roles such as Payroll Administrator or Payroll Assistant.
However, as you gain experience, you can progress into payroll management positions, earning an average of £41,000 per annum.
So, if you enjoy working with numbers, problem-solving, and playing an important role in how businesses operate, a career in payroll can be incredibly rewarding.

You don’t always need formal qualifications to start working in payroll, but having payroll training or a recognised payroll qualification can make it much easier to get started and progress in the field.
Many people begin their payroll career in entry-level roles such as Payroll Administrator, Payroll Assistant, or Finance Assistant, where they learn the basics of payroll processes and payroll software on the job.
However, employers often look for candidates who already understand key areas such as payslips, tax deductions, and payroll legislation.
Enrolling on an accredited payroll course is a great way to build these skills and demonstrate your knowledge to employers.
